About Capital One Financial Corporation

Capital One Financial Corporation is a major U.S.-based bank holding company, known for its credit card, auto loan, banking, and savings account products. The company is publicly traded under the ticker symbol COF and is considered one of the largest financial institutions in the United States.

In recent years, Capital One has sought to expand its footprint in the financial services sector, including through proposed acquisitions such as its bid for Discover Financial Services. The company’s growth strategies and risk management practices are closely watched by investors, regulators, and market analysts alike.

The Allegations

The current investigation centers on whether Capital One and its management misled investors about the company’s credit quality and risk controls during a period of rising internal credit losses and loan delinquencies. Specifically, it is alleged that, despite mounting evidence of adverse trends, management continued to make optimistic statements and failed to disclose material information to the market prior to April 2025.

Between April 2 and April 10, 2025, Capital One’s stock price experienced a significant decline. This drop was triggered by broader macroeconomic events—such as the announcement of sweeping U.S. tariffs—but was further compounded by company-specific issues. These included rising credit losses, uncertainty surrounding the proposed acquisition of Discover Financial Services, and increased regulatory and media scrutiny. Additionally, recent litigation by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) and large-scale institutional sales contributed to negative investor sentiment.

Importantly, while Capital One’s public disclosures emphasized the company’s resilience and credit quality, new evidence suggests that management may have failed to adequately inform investors about increasing loan delinquencies and other material risks.
